UPVC Window Repair

Upvc Window repairs windows are energy efficient and durable. They require minimal maintenance. But, as with any door or window, they can get damaged over time.

doorpanels-300x200.jpg?Fortunately, a majority of uPVC window repair issues can be resolved by homeowners without needing to engage a professional. This article will cover the most common issues and the best way to solve it:

Frame Fragment Damage

Upvc windows are an eco green choice for homes. They are easy to maintain and reduce greenhouse emissions. uPVC can be damaged. A damaged window can cause leaks, drafts and reduced insulation. If you're experiencing these problems, it is crucial to seek help from a professional as soon as possible.

The most frequent issue with uPVC windows is the frame getting damaged. It can be caused by damage or lack of maintenance. It is important to inspect your windows on a regular basis for signs and damage, and repair them as quickly as you can. If the damage is serious it might be required to replace the entire window.

Another common issue with uPVC windows is the presence of condensation between the glass units. This is an indication of a failing seal in the glass unit. A specialist uPVC repair service can repair this.

The frames of uPVC windows can also become damaged if they are exposed to sunlight. This can make them brittle and lead to cracks and dents. It is crucial to wash the uPVC regularly with non-abrasive cleaning products like WD-40 or soapy water. This will stop moisture from soaking into the wood and causing damage.

A damaged or cracked uPVC window can be difficult to open and close. It can also allow for water to get in which could lead to mold and other problems. It is important to fix the problem immediately to avoid further damage to the window and ensure that it is properly insulate.

When it comes to fixing uPVC windows, the best option is to make use of epoxy. It comes in different colors and is a great option for small scratches and dents on the window's surface. Use a high-quality epoxy and follow the instructions of the manufacturer when applying the. This will ensure that the uPVC is as good as brand new. This task should be completed by a professional, as doing it yourself could be risky.

Condensation on Inside Face of Glass

UPVC windows are a great choice for commercial or residential property as they provide durability, thermal efficiency and require minimal maintenance. However, issues occur with your windows and it is important to understand what these are and how they can be repaired.

One common problem with uPVC window is condensation on the inside of the glass. This is typically caused by the seal that separates the two panes. If this happens, moisture could enter the gap and cause it to become cloudy. This can be prevented by cleaning windows frequently and boosting the temperature of kitchens and bathrooms and making sure there is enough ventilation.

Water leakage between the glass panes is a different problem that can occur when using uPVC Windows. This can be due to many things, such as a defective argon filler or a weak seal between the spacers as well as the glass. Ingress of water from the outside that is not treated could cause damp patches to appear on the walls, and also mold growth around window frames. The damp can also cause damage to wallpaper and paint which causes it to peel or flake. It can also harm curtains and blinds, causing them to rip or hang poorly.

A window that is leaking could be a health and safety issue, however in some instances, it might not be. It should be addressed as soon as it is possible to prevent further damage. It is recommended to seek out a uPVC repair expert if you notice an issue with the water. They will examine the damage and make any necessary repairs.

If you are having difficulty opening your uPVC windows, this could be a sign that there's a problem with the hinges or handles. In some instances it is possible that an upvc window repair near me repair specialist can fix hinges or handles to restore the original functionality of your windows.

It is recommended that you clean your UPVC windows twice a year. This can be done by using a soft cloth to remove any cobwebs or dirt and then using a window cleaner that does not leave a streaky finish. You should always avoid using harsh chemicals since this could cause damage to the window.

Stiff Window Mechanism

A upvc which does not seal properly can let heat escape, resulting in more expensive heating bills and a drafty house. It can also weaken your security fences and let in mice, insects and other unwanted pests. The gap could also cause condensation and mould to form. This is an easy solution. Contact your local upvc company to adjust the locking mechanism of the handle so that it fits more tightly against the frame.

The hinges on windows made of upvc may also become stiff or difficult to open or close. If this is the case then you must ensure that the hinges are clear of dirt or other debris and that they are properly lubricated. This can be accomplished by taking off the handle and the screw caps that hold it in place.

After you have removed the handle you can then use some lubricant to gently move the mechanism back into place. Be cautious when using any lubricant, however, as upvc is very sensitive to certain chemicals and therefore you must find an option that is safe for this particular material.

Sometimes, windows made of upvc become stiff due to having been closed for a long period of time in hot weather. This can cause the gasket that connects the sash and frame to melt slightly, which can then prevent the window from opening. In this scenario it is recommended to allow the window to open naturally as the temperature drops and avoid trying to force it open as this could cause the gasket to break apart and create a draught through your window.

In most instances, a sluggish Upvc window is the result of either lack of lubrication or water in the operating mechanism that has corroded it. It could result in the lock or handle becoming difficult to turn, requiring more force each time. This can eventually cause them to break or get stuck permanently. This is why it's always best to seek professional help from a upvc specialist instead of trying to fix the problem yourself since it will be much cheaper and also far safer for you and your family.
